Now that I've used the 490 (JD450) a lot lately, I'm really liking it! One change I made from the original kit was down sizing the Jung pump from 4003 (0,45ml/rev) to a 4002 (0,30ml/rev), with pump motor set to 6500rpm max, flow is approx 420ml/min making boom/stick movement a lot less springy, much easier to control with smooth fluent motion.
